Real-Time Streaming Protocol (RTSP) is a network communication protocol designed for controlling media sessions between a client and a server. It allows for the efficient delivery of streaming media, enabling various applications and services that require real-time communication and interaction. In this article, we will delve into the various applications of RTSP, exploring its utilization in video surveillance systems, live streaming services, video conferencing platforms, and more, highlighting its versatility and significance in the digital domain.
RTSP: Understanding The Basics And Its Protocol
RTSP, which stands for Real-Time Streaming Protocol, is a communication protocol widely used for controlling streaming media servers. With the ability to efficiently transmit real-time video and audio data, RTSP plays a crucial role in the realm of multimedia streaming applications.
The protocol operates on top of the Transmission Control Protocol (TCP) or the User Datagram Protocol (UDP), facilitating the control, delivery, and synchronization of a live or pre-recorded media stream. RTSP allows clients to initiate, pause, play, and stop the streaming sessions, providing a framework for media operations.
Furthermore, RTSP supports a range of multimedia formats, including audio/video formats, metadata, timing information, and more. By utilizing RTSP, clients can easily access and control multimedia content from media servers, ensuring reliable and efficient communication between the server and the client.
In summary, RTSP’s basics and protocol understanding are crucial for effectively leveraging this technology to deliver high-quality streaming media content and improving user experience across various applications.
Real-Time Streaming Protocol: Enabling High-Quality Video Streaming
The Real-Time Streaming Protocol (RTSP) plays a crucial role in enabling high-quality video streaming over networks. With the proliferation of video content and the growing demand for live streaming, RTSP has become an essential technology for delivering real-time media.
RTSP acts as a control protocol, allowing clients to initiate, pause, resume, and stop the streaming of audio and video data. It works in conjunction with other protocols such as RTP (Real-Time Transport Protocol) for efficient transmission of multimedia content.
One of the primary advantages of RTSP is its ability to provide low-latency streaming, ensuring minimal delay between the capture of video content and its delivery to end users. This makes it ideal for applications where real-time interaction and immediate access to video content are critical, such as live sports events, news broadcasting, and online gaming.
Furthermore, RTSP allows for adaptive streaming, which means that it can adjust the quality and bitrate of the video stream based on the network conditions and the capabilities of the receiving device. This ensures a smooth viewing experience even in situations where network bandwidth fluctuates.
In conclusion, RTSP plays a pivotal role in enabling high-quality video streaming, offering low latency, adaptive streaming, and seamless control over multimedia content. Its applications extend to various realms, from live events and video conferencing to media servers and IoT devices.
RTSP As A Key Technology For Video Surveillance Systems
Video surveillance systems play a crucial role in maintaining security and monitoring activities in various environments. RTSP has emerged as a key technology in enhancing the capabilities of these systems.
RTSP allows for the seamless integration of video surveillance cameras with recording and playback devices, providing real-time access to live streams and recorded footage. With the ability to control multiple cameras simultaneously, RTSP enables users to monitor different locations from a centralized interface.
One of the significant advantages of using RTSP in video surveillance systems is its ability to support high-quality video streaming. This ensures that every frame of the video is delivered with minimal latency and without compromising image resolution. Whether it is in indoor or outdoor environments, RTSP provides reliable and efficient streaming, allowing security personnel to closely monitor critical areas.
Furthermore, RTSP supports advanced features such as motion detection, event-triggered recording, and pan-tilt-zoom control. These features enhance the intelligence and automation of video surveillance systems, improving their effectiveness in detecting and responding to potential security threats.
In conclusion, RTSP serves as a crucial technology for video surveillance systems, enabling real-time access to live streams, high-quality video streaming, and advanced features for enhanced security and monitoring. Its integration with recording and playback devices enhances the overall functionality and efficiency of video surveillance systems.
Utilizing RTSP For Live Streaming Of Events And Webcasting
Live streaming has become increasingly popular in recent years, allowing users to broadcast events and webcasts in real time to a global audience. This is where RTSP (Real-Time Streaming Protocol) plays a crucial role.
RTSP enables the seamless delivery of live content, such as concerts, sports events, conferences, and webinars, to viewers around the world. It facilitates the transmission of audio and video data in real time, ensuring a smooth and uninterrupted streaming experience.
One of the key advantages of using RTSP for live streaming is its ability to handle large volumes of data efficiently. It allows for the creation of high-quality live streams that can be accessed by thousands, or even millions, of viewers simultaneously. This ensures that events can be shared with a wide audience, regardless of their geographical location.
Moreover, RTSP supports various video codecs and streaming formats, making it compatible with a wide range of devices and platforms. This ensures that viewers can access live streams on their desired devices, including smartphones, tablets, PCs, and smart TVs.
In conclusion, RTSP is an essential technology for live streaming of events and webcasting, providing a reliable and scalable solution for delivering real-time content to a global audience.
RTSP In Video Conferencing: Enhancing Communication And Collaboration
RTSP plays a crucial role in enhancing communication and collaboration in video conferencing systems. Video conferencing enables individuals or groups to connect and communicate in real-time, regardless of their physical location. RTSP ensures smooth transmission of audio and video streams, facilitating seamless interaction among participants.
By utilizing RTSP, video conferencing platforms can provide high-quality video and audio streaming, enabling participants to have clear and uninterrupted communication. RTSP ensures low-latency delivery of media streams, minimizing delays and ensuring a real-time experience for all users.
Moreover, RTSP allows video conferencing systems to support various features such as screen sharing, document collaboration, and remote desktop control. These features enhance collaboration during meetings, allowing participants to share their screens, present documents, and work collectively on projects.
Furthermore, RTSP enables video conferencing platforms to integrate with other communication tools such as instant messaging and file sharing applications. This integration enhances the overall collaboration experience by enabling participants to seamlessly switch between different modes of communication and share files during video conferences.
In conclusion, RTSP plays a crucial role in video conferencing systems by ensuring high-quality streaming, supporting collaboration features, and facilitating seamless integration with other communication tools. Its use in video conferencing enhances communication and collaboration, making it an essential technology in the modern workplace.
RTSP Applications in Media Servers and Video-on-Demand Services
RTSP Applications In Media Servers And Video-on-Demand Services
RTSP plays a crucial role in the efficient functioning of media servers and video-on-demand (VOD) services. Media servers rely on RTSP to deliver content, while VOD services heavily utilize this protocol to enable seamless streaming experiences.
By leveraging RTSP, media servers can effectively distribute audio and video content to various clients or devices. This enables users to access their desired media files from a centralized server, enhancing convenience and accessibility. RTSP allows media servers to provide real-time streaming or on-demand content based on user preferences.
Moreover, Video-on-Demand services heavily rely on RTSP for smooth delivery of video content. This protocol facilitates quick and efficient retrieval of files from storage systems, allowing users to access a wide range of movies, TV shows, or other multimedia content on-demand. RTSP ensures that the playback is seamless, regardless of the user’s internet speed or device capabilities.
Overall, the applications of RTSP in media servers and video-on-demand services demonstrate its significance in enhancing users’ media consumption experiences and establishing a robust infrastructure for multimedia content delivery.
Exploring RTSP’s Role In IoT Devices And Smart Home Automation Systems
In recent years, there has been a significant rise in the adoption of IoT devices and smart home automation systems. These innovative technologies have revolutionized the way we interact with our homes and the appliances within them. One crucial component that enables seamless communication and control between these devices is the Real-Time Streaming Protocol (RTSP).
RTSP plays a vital role in the IoT ecosystem by allowing the streaming of audio and video data from IoT devices to various platforms. It enables homeowners to monitor their homes remotely, providing real-time video feeds from surveillance cameras and other smart devices. Whether it’s checking who’s at the front door or keeping an eye on pets while at work, RTSP ensures a secure and reliable connection.
Moreover, RTSP’s integration with smart home automation systems allows users to control and manipulate IoT devices through a centralized platform. With the help of RTSP, users can remotely adjust lighting, temperature, and other home functions, improving convenience and energy efficiency.
As IoT devices continue to transform our homes, RTSP will undoubtedly remain a front and center technology, facilitating seamless communication and control within the IoT ecosystem.
FAQ
1. What is RTSP used for?
RTSP, which stands for Real-Time Streaming Protocol, is primarily used for establishing and controlling media sessions between a server and client devices. It enables efficient streaming of audio and video content over a network.
2. What are the main applications of RTSP?
RTSP has a wide range of applications in various domains. It is frequently used for IP cameras, video surveillance systems, live streaming platforms, and video conferencing services. It also finds utility in multimedia servers, online gaming, and broadcasting environments.
3. How does RTSP facilitate media streaming?
RTSP functions as a control protocol, working alongside other protocols like RTP (Real-Time Transport Protocol) and RTCP (Real-Time Control Protocol), to manage media streaming sessions. It establishes the communication channel, controls the flow of media data, and ensures synchronization between server and client devices.
4. Can RTSP be used for on-demand and live streaming?
Absolutely. RTSP supports both on-demand streaming, where pre-recorded content is streamed to clients, and live streaming, where real-time content is broadcasted. It enables viewers to access live events or watch recorded media files seamlessly over the internet.
The Bottom Line
In conclusion, RTSP (Real-Time Streaming Protocol) is a powerful protocol used for controlling and delivering real-time media content over the internet. Its applications are diverse and extensive, with uses ranging from video surveillance and live streaming to video conferencing and interactive learning. The ability to establish and manage connections, control media playback, and exchange metadata make RTSP an essential tool in various industries. As technology continues to evolve, RTSP is expected to play a crucial role in enabling seamless real-time communication and content delivery.